GENERAL DESCRIPTION: From the get-in and for the first couple of miles, the river banks have been built up and the river artificially straightened, making for dull paddling (fast Grade 1 and 2). Its catchment area includes the northern flanks of Wetherlam, Great Carrs and others of the Furness Fells, as well as a substantial area of the Langdale Fells.
